Blowing huge leads at the Master's is best avoided by playing
this game and having horrible days on the fairways. With that
as a given, here are some practical tips for keeping your s
core down while playing the software game:

1. Change the type of ball you use between holes.
A solid ball can give you more distance at warmer
temperatures.

2. Set up your shot the same way each time.
Make it a routine so you don't forget any
part of the shot.

3. When playing an uphill shot, aim a little
against your natural draw.


4. When playing a downhill shot, aim a little
against your natural fade.

5. To clear a tree, hit high and hard with as
little club as possible.

6. Push your putts to ensure they aren't left short.
